Toddler mistakenly dials 911 — leading to mother’s arrest on warrant

A toddler who mistakenly dialed 911 led to the child’s mother being arrested on a Bartholomew County warrant.

Columbus Police were sent to the 2200 block of Sims Court at about noon Sunday when officers were told it appeared a child was playing with a telephone in an apartment there, said Lt. Matt Harris, Columbus Police Department spokesman.

Dispatchers also told the officers that a Bartholomew Superior Court 2 warrant was pending for the resident of the apartment, Paris M. Mann, 29, Columbus, Harris said.

Officers arrested Mann on the warrant and the child remained in the care of another family member, police said.
